What is an “Arabic Style Mirror”?

It is a large, ornate, wall-mounted mirror, traditionally framed with materials like dark-stained wood, gold-leafed wood, or metal. The design is heavily influenced by Islamic art and architecture, drawing from centuries-old traditions that emphasize geometry, symmetry, and intricate patterns.

They are not just functional items but are considered significant pieces of art that add grandeur, a sense of history, and cultural elegance to a space.


Key Design Features & Characteristics

  1. Intricate Geometric Patterns (Girih):

    • This is the most defining feature. The frames are carved with complex, interlocking geometric designs—stars, polygons, and strapwork patterns. This reflects the Islamic artistic principle of using geometry to represent the infinite nature of creation, avoiding figurative images.

  2. Arches and Islamic Motifs:

    • The top of the mirror often features a prominent arch, most commonly a pointed arch or a horseshoe arch, reminiscent of those found in mosques and palaces.

    • Other common motifs include arabesques (floral and vegetal patterns), calligraphic designs, and patterns inspired by mashrabiya (lattice screens).

  3. Rich and Opulent Finishes:

    • Gold Leaf: A very popular and classic finish that exudes luxury and tradition.

    • Dark Wood: Stained in deep browns, espresso, or black for a more traditional, majestic look.

    • Antique Silver or Bronze: Offers a slightly more modern or subdued take on the classic style.

    • Colorful Inlays: Some higher-end pieces feature inlays of mother-of-pearl, stained glass, or colored stones.

  4. Large Scale and Statement Presence:

    • These mirrors are designed to be a focal point. They are typically quite large and heavy, meant to be placed above a main sofa, in a grand entrance hallway, or above a fireplace.


Why is it Associated with Abu Dhabi?

Abu Dhabi, as the capital of the UAE, is a hub where traditional Emirati and Arab heritage meets modern luxury. This style of mirror is ubiquitous here for several reasons:

  • Cultural Aesthetic: It fits perfectly with the overall design language of traditional Emirati homes and modern spaces that wish to incorporate local cultural elements.

  • Souqs and Traditional Crafts: The areas around Madinat Zayed Gold Centre and the older souqs are filled with shops specializing in these mirrors. Many are imported from other countries known for woodworking (like Morocco, India, and Syria), but they are a fundamental part of the home décor market in Abu Dhabi.

  • Modern Interpretations: Interior designers in Abu Dhabi’s luxury hotels, palaces, and high-end villas frequently use these mirrors to add a touch of authentic, regional glamour to contemporary spaces.


Where to Find Them in Abu Dhabi

If you are in Abu Dhabi and looking to purchase one, here are the best places to go:

  1. Madinat Zayed Shopping Centre (and surrounding area): This is the number one destination. The ground floor and the streets around the centre are packed with stores selling furniture and decorative items, with dozens of shops dedicated almost exclusively to these ornate mirrors in every size and style imaginable.

  2. The Old Souq (Souq Central Market): While more focused on textiles and gifts, you can find smaller decorative items and sometimes mirrors in the surrounding streets.

  3. Interior Design Stores: Higher-end furniture and design boutiques in areas like Khalidiya, Al Bateen, and on Airport Road will carry more refined, and often more expensive, versions of these mirrors.

  4. Online Marketplaces: For residents, sites like Dubizzle Abu Dhabi often have listings for both new and used Arabic style mirrors.
